In Hopkinton, the most common ant species include carpenter ants, pavement ants, odorous house ants, and citronella ants. Carpenter ants are particularly prevalent due to the region's wooded areas and older homes with moisture issues. They nest in damp wood and can weaken structural elements. Pavement ants typically nest in cracks in driveways and foundations, while odorous house ants are known for invading kitchens in search of sugary foods. Citronella ants are less common but can appear in basements and emit a lemony scent when crushed. Each type requires different control methods, so proper identification is essential for effective extermination.
Signs of carpenter ants include seeing large black ants inside your home, particularly at night, as they are nocturnal foragers. You might hear faint rustling within walls if an infestation is active. Look for small piles of sawdust-like material called frass, which is pushed out of their nesting tunnels. Unlike termites, carpenter ants don't eat wood; they excavate it to build their nests. You may also find winged ants emerging from walls or ceilings during mating season. In Hopkinton, these infestations are often linked to moisture problems from the region's humid summers and wet winters, so checking areas near plumbing or damp wood is crucial.

Recurring ant problems are common in Hopkinton due to several environmental and structural factors. The area's mix of forested and residential land creates ideal nesting conditions. Ants may return if only foragers were killed during treatment, leaving the colony intact. Another common reason is the presence of multiple nests or satellite colonies. Structural gaps in foundations, unsealed entry points, and persistent moisture issues also allow ants to re-enter. Additionally, if food sources like pet food, crumbs, or sugary items aren’t stored properly, they can attract new ants even after treatment. Thorough monitoring and follow-up actions are necessary to break the infestation cycle.
Ant activity in Hopkinton typically peaks in late spring through early fall, with May to September being the most active months. Warmer temperatures stimulate colony growth and foraging behavior. Carpenter ants may become visible indoors earlier in the year if their nest is already inside a warm structure. Rainy springs can also push ants indoors as they seek drier ground. Autumn may see a decline in activity, but some ants, like odorous house ants, can continue invading homes through the fall if indoor conditions remain favorable. Preventive measures are best taken in early spring before colonies reach their peak population.

Most ants in Hopkinton are not directly harmful to human health, but they can still pose indirect risks. Odorous house ants and pavement ants can contaminate food as they travel through unsanitary areas before entering your home. Their trails may pass over pet waste, trash, or decaying organic matter. Carpenter ants can damage wooden structures over time, leading to costly repairs. Some people may also experience allergic reactions to ant bites or stings, though this is rare in Rhode Island's native species. Keeping your home clean and sealing entry points helps minimize the health risks associated with an infestation.

To prevent ants from returning in Hopkinton, start with exterior maintenance. Seal cracks in the foundation, window frames, and door thresholds. Install weather stripping and repair torn screens. Keep firewood and mulch piles away from your home’s foundation. Indoors, store food in airtight containers and clean up spills promptly. Fix any leaky pipes or areas of standing water, especially in basements and bathrooms. Reduce clutter to limit nesting sites and regularly vacuum to eliminate food particles and scent trails. Consider using natural deterrents like vinegar sprays along common entry points. Routine inspections can help catch early signs before they become infestations.
